Anyways, let's start with "what does contribute server specifically provide that Contribute alone doesn't?"
I presume you're referring to CPS (Contribute Publishing Server). We have been using it since it first came out several years ago and have been relatively pleased with it overall. I had expected Macromedia to do more with it as it has a huge potential to do much more, but they really didn't develop it. I was hoping they would implement an automatic link & spell checker or somthing. Now that it's in Adobe's hands, I really consider it a dead product. In fact, it won't install on Windows Server 2008 without running the installer in compatibility mode. It's still at version 1.11 and there hasn't been a release in about 5 years.
It's biggest benefit is not having to deal with connection keys. People authenticate using their Windows domain credentials and it sets up the connection automatically. It also sends me an email notification automatically when something gets published so I know to push it live from our staging server. It also maintains a log of all activity and comments, but that usefulness has turned out to be minimal.
Now that CS5 supports subversion, the benefit of CPS really seems minimal since subversion can be configured to send email notifications. Since I already have CPS, I'm eager to implement subversion along side it, but if that doesn't work, I won't hesitate to ditch CPS altogether. At some point, CPS will be incompatible with a Windows release and I don't expect Adobe to do anything to fix it.
If you don't have to deal with administering tons of users, I don't think it's worth it.

JordanWhen I say use certificates, there should be a checkbox with "check signature". This ensure that only sap machines with an active certificate can access the content server.
On the file system, I would ensure that no users have access to the file system through the backend. If they can modify documents, you will be sitting with major problems from a document integrity and legal perspective.
On the issue of migration, there is an oss note for the migration of data from one repository to another for archivelink.
Check note number 1043676
Symptom
You have created a new repository, and would like to migrate the ArchiveLink Documents to the new repository.
Other terms
Migration of documents, ArchiveLink, repository
Reason and Prerequisites
This report helps migration of ArchiveLink documents.
To use this report effectively, you would need to ensure that you apply the note 732436. However, this note will allow the migration of documents from and to type of repositories which are supported by ArchiveLink. The types of repositories that are supported by ArchiveLink are HTTP, RFC and R/3 Database.
Solution
Before you execute the report, you must set up a repository that can
store the documents (transaction OAC0). The repository may be in an
external archive(connected via HTTP or RFC) or (as of Basis Release 6.10) in the OLTP database of the SAP system. You can also use SAP Content Server as an external archive for storing documents.
The report has the following parameters:
OLD_ARC ID of the old repository previously used
NEW_ARC ID of the new repository
TEST_RUN: If you enable this, only a test run occurs, copy of documents does not occur.
DEL_FILE: If you enable this, then the files would be deleted from the old repository.
Launch the transaction SE38 and create a program with the name ZMIGRATE_ARCHIVELINK_FILES. Once the program is created, now copy the code from the correction instruction. -

Verifying the Installed Locales
1.Reboot the system
Once you have added the localized packages, make sure to reboot the system before using the locale. This is not always needed, but is needed for some of the locales.
2.Setting the locale in your environment
When the system comes up, your target locale should be listed in the locale selection menu of dtlogin. Select it, and start the desktop from dtlogin If you are not using dtlogin (2.5.1 without CDE, for instance), set the LANG environment to your locale name. It is also advised to set LC_ALL to the same locale name.
From C shell, if you want to set the locale to ja (Japanese), for instance: % setenv LANG ja
% setenv LC_ALL ja
From Korn shell, if you want to set the locale to fr (French), for example: $ export LANG=fr $ export LC_ALL=fr Then, start openwin.
You could have locale sensitive X resources in your .Xdefaults or .OWdefaults. For instance:
OpenWindows.BasicLocale
If your selected locale does not seem to be activated, there is a chance that some of the resources are conflicting. It also happens that you may have font preference in your X resources. Remember that font availablity can be different per locale. Please eliminate locale dependent font settings in your environment when you test under different locales.
3.Checking the character output
Depending on whether you have installed Full locale or Partial locale, the strings on the desktop may be or may not be localized. Once the desktop is started, bring up a shelltool (or dtterm), and execute:
% date
The date command should print out the localized time data to you. By doing this, you have verified that the locale is correctly installed, and the fonts are loaded properly.
4.Checking the character input
Next thing to verify is the input mechanism for the locale. In one of
Chinese/Japanese/Korean locales, please also make sure t hat the system automatically starts a XIM (X Input Method) server. In these locales, the footer area for each shellWidget has extra space to display the current input mode string. Usually, Ctrl-space is assigned as the toggle key to turn on/off Asian language input. In Western European locales, XIM server is not started, and the extra footer area is not allocated either. One typical way to verify the character input mechanism using the US keyboard is to type in :-
Compose_key + a + double_quote
This key sequence will generate a-umlaut.
5.Ready to test your software
Now, you are ready to test your software in the target locale.
Asian Locales for Solaris 2.6
Note: Adding more than one asian locale can cause problems with the BCP packages. If you are going to add more than one asian locale, please do NOT add the BCP packages (SUNWxxbcp).
The asian locales that are supported are:
Japanese EUC Japanes e PCK Korean Korean UTF-8 Simplified Chinese Traditional Chinese Traditional Chinese BIG5
All Asian locales require the following packages:
SUNWale - Asian Language Environment Common Files
SUNWaled - Asian Language Environment Common Man Pages
SUNWxi18n - X Window System I18N Common Package
SUNWxim - X Window System X Input Method Server Package -

Thanks for your helpYour code has a couple of problems.
1) the server doesn't flush its socket, so nothing will actually be sent until the socket is closed.
2) the client getResponse() reads until end of file, so an attempt to use it a second time will fail
3) in a real application the server should use threads. See the echo server I posted in http://forum.java.sun.com/thread.jsp?forum=11&thread=526980 reply 3.

Question : Service Accounts for SQL Server 2012
Hello,
I am planning to create AD accounts for SQL Server 2012 services that will be installed on Windows 2012 server.
I was reading the following
Configure Windows Service Accounts and Permissions
and
Windows Privileges and Rights
Is there a recommendation / document that would list that assocation of SQL Server Services with Actvie Directory service accounts / privileges required for installation and starting the services.
Isn't it recommended to create separate account for every service and they should not be local accounts ?
Hope to hear soon as to what industry standards are being followed for production systems ?
Thank you very much in advance.
Regards
NikunjFrom MSDN:
Each service in SQL Server represents a process or a set of processes to manage authentication of SQL Server operations with Windows. Each service can be configured to use its own service account. This facility is exposed
at installation. SQL Server provides a special tool, SQL Server Configuration Manager, to manage the services configuration.
When choosing service accounts, consider the principle of least privilege. The service account should have exactly the privileges that it needs to do its job and no more privileges. You also need to consider account isolation; the service accounts should
not only be different from one another, they should not be used by any other service on the same server. Do not grant additional permissions to the SQL Server service account or the service groups.
From Glen Berry's Blog:
You should request that a dedicated domain user account be created for use by the SQL Server service. This should just be a regular, domain account with no special rights on the domain. You do not need or want this account to be a local admin on the machine
where SQL Server will be installed. The SQL Server setup program will grant the necessary rights on the machine to that account during installation.
You will also want a separate, dedicated domain user account for the SQL Server Agent service. If you are going to be installing and using other SQL Server related services such as SQL Server Integration Services (SSIS), SQL Server Reporting Services (SSRS),
or SQL Server Analysis Services (SSAS), you will want dedicated domain accounts for each service. The reason you want separate accounts for each service is because they require different rights on the local machine, and having separate accounts is both more
secure and more resilient, since a problem with one account won’t affect all of the SQL Server Services.
Depending on your organization, getting these domain accounts created could take anywhere from minutes to weeks to complete, so make sure to allow time for this. For each one of these accounts, you will need their logon credentials for the SQL Server setup
program. You are going to want to make sure that the accounts don’t have a temporary password that must be changed during the next login. If they are set up that way, make sure to change them to use a strong password, and record this information in a secure
location.

Thanks aliianThanks to those contributing this fix -- had this issue on my son's iPad mini and was going crazy trying to figure it out!!
To answer the question of why this causes an issue: this is part of the standard security features of the internet - when you connect securely to a server (as the i-devices do when accessing itunes), it has an SSL Certificate which has an expiry date on it -- the device checks the certificate to try and make sure you aren't getting duped by an out of date certificate, and if your date is set too far in the future (my son's was in 2019!) then it looks like the expiry date is in the past and it won't let you connect..
